Insulation seams/joints not sealed
Seal insulation seams so the vapor barrier is continuous. Open seams let moisture, dirt, and air movement get into the insulation.
Watch out
- Do not leave seams open because they face the deck or wall.
Check
- Check lap direction and seam overlap.
- Use the approved tape/mastic/jacket closure for the insulation system.
- Seal corners, fittings, and underside seams - not just the easy face.
- Recheck after the duct is bumped or moved.
